Output 74bd26259c0de338002ab1da6aaabf40e9678b43e33a625b595f8cbd7d815971:8

value
24749084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15dfa42d4ec4cc0df66dc4745bef298435e720b7 OP_EQUAL
address
M9tpLL5NFgt6LdbjTpfwvtcaDftQCm1xCf
transaction
74bd26259c0de338002ab1da6aaabf40e9678b43e33a625b595f8cbd7d815971
spent
true